SOVIET PARLIAMENT

FRANCHISE TO WORKERS POlil- RVETIY I<T\T. VEARS ' I:ir.\ Tel. Copyi-ijrht- United !><>.«« Assn.) LONDON, .lune ;.'. 'l'll, Xeusl'iiionicle's Moscow' •- .cspondoiil reports thai the draft of ih,.' new Soviet consiiintion provides for a I'aiiianieni to be elected every ii\,. years, consisting of a Lower ||,m,,. n|' lidl.l members, where all legistuiiiiii will be. initiated, and an Upper House of '2OO members.

The franchise will be gran-led lo all workers, including clergymen and former Tsftrisi otlteinls, hitherto disfranchised.

Parliament will assemble twice uninially for a period of tin da'y.s for each session.
